Abstract
A case of suprasellar germinoma with subarachnoid seeding is presented. Patient had
a history of depression unresponsive to drug therapy and recently developed diabetes
insipidus. MR imaging revealed a huge suprasellar mass, heterogenous in signal intensity
due to cystic components. MR spectroscopy of the mass showed prominent lipid peak
suggesting high malignant potential.
